In Pennsylvania, a Sample Letter for Reminder to Employee to Renew their Driver's License is typically issued to employees who have been identified as having an upcoming expiration date for their driver's license. This letter serves as a friendly reminder to the employee, encouraging them to initiate the process of renewing their driver's license in a timely manner. The purpose of this letter is to ensure that all employees are in compliance with state regulations, as driving with an expired license is against the law and can result in various penalties and fines. By sending out this reminder letter, the employer is taking proactive measures to ensure the safety and legal compliance of their employees. When drafting the letter, several relevant keywords and elements should be included to ensure clarity and effectiveness. These may include: 1. Greeting: The letter should start with a polite and professional greeting, such as "Dear [Employee's Name]". This creates a formal tone while maintaining a respectful approach. 2. Introduction: Begin the letter by briefly explaining the purpose of the communication. For example, "We are writing to remind you of the upcoming expiration date of your Pennsylvania driver's license." 3. Employee Information: Include the employee's full name, position, and department to personalize the letter and confirm that it is being sent to the correct recipient. 4. Expiration Date: Clearly state the specific expiration date of the employee's driver's license to create a sense of urgency and remind the employee of the importance of renewing it promptly. 5. State Regulations: Highlight the legal requirement for employees to hold a valid driver's license while operating a company vehicle or conducting work-related activities that involve driving. 6. Employee Responsibility: Emphasize that it is the responsibility of the employee to renew their license in a timely manner and remind them that driving with an expired license is not only illegal but may also affect their ability to perform their job duties that require driving. 7. Consequences of Non-Compliance: Briefly outline the potential consequences of driving with an expired license, such as penalties, fines, and potential impact on the employee's insurance coverage. 8. Encouragement to Take Action: Encourage the employee to start the renewal process as soon as possible by providing information on the steps they need to take, such as scheduling an appointment at the nearest Pennsylvania Department of Transportation (Penn DOT) office. 9. Contact Information: Include contact information for the company's HR department or a designated point of contact who can answer any questions or provide further assistance regarding the license renewal process. 10. Closing: End the letter with a polite closing, such as "Thank you for your attention to this matter" or "We appreciate your cooperation in ensuring compliance with state regulations." It's important to note that there may not be different types of Pennsylvania Sample Letters for Reminder to Employee to Renew their Driver's License, as the purpose and content of such letters typically remain the same. However, the specific language and format may vary based on the company's internal policies, the employee's position, and other factors determined by the employer.
